5. Challenges and Drawbacks:
While online poker brings many benefits, it is not without its challenges. One of many major drawbacks is the possibility deceptive activities, including collusion and chip dumping, where players cheat to get an unfair advantage. But reputable online poker platforms use robust security steps and random number generators to thwart such behavior. Furthermore, some players could find the absence of physical cues and communications which are element of live poker games a disadvantage, as it can be harder to learn opponents and use mental strategies on line.
